About The Position

The Project Manager – Supply Chain (Program Management) is responsible for leading end‑to‑end material management strategy and execution for major capital projects. This role ensures the right materials are planned, sourced, staged, delivered, and available to construction partners at the right time to reduce delays, drive cost efficiency, and improve field execution. This position will partner closely with key stakeholders to provide project-level oversight across planning, procurement, logistics, risk mitigation, and coordination of all material-related activities throughout the project lifecycle. Responsibilities

  • Develop comprehensive material management plans for assigned capital projects, aligned with scope, schedule, cost, sequencing, and field execution needs.
  • Validate BOMs, long‑lead items, critical material constraints, and forecasted demand with engineering and construction partners.
  • Identify material risks early and build mitigation plans (supplier alternatives, staging strategies, contingency inventory, etc.).
  • Partner with procurement and suppliers to ensure timely purchase requisitions, competitive sourcing (as required), and alignment with contract terms.
  • Monitor supplier performance, manufacturing schedules, and delivery commitments; proactively resolve issues.
  • Coordinate with Supply Chain Operations to ensure materials are staged, kitted, and delivered according to the construction schedule.
  • Oversee material management plans and ensure storage conditions, handling requirements, and tracking are executed correctly.
  • Conduct periodic site visits to validate material availability, quality, and readiness.
  • Monitor material budgets, variances, and cost drivers; provide updates to project controls and Supply Chain leadership.
  • Track all material‑related activities against plan (deliveries, delays, shortages, surplus, changes).
  • Serve as the primary Supply Chain liaison for all material‑related aspects of assigned capital projects.
  • Facilitate coordination among engineering, construction, procurement, suppliers, warehousing, and logistics stakeholders.
  • Prepare and present status updates, risks, and mitigation plans to project teams and leadership.
  • Identify opportunities to strengthen material management processes and eliminate recurring causes of material delays.
  • Support implementation of standardized SC project workflows, templates, reporting, and lessons learned.
